Background / History
Ariel is the five-year-old second princess of the Asura Kingdom when she is introduced at a palace ball. She is regarded as highly ambitious and politically gifted, with a strong likelihood of eventually becoming queen. The king appoints Luke Notos Greyrat and Dolin Prodia Greyrat as her Guardian Knights, tying the Notos and Prodia families to her safety. 13
Although Dolin initially neglects his position and intimidates Ariel’s companions, Ariel begins building her own support base through public appearances. She visits wounded soldiers, aids disabled people and orphans, presents medals to returning knights, and gives speeches to commoners and soldiers. 14 17
An assassination attempt while Ariel is traveling in disguise kills several people around her. She remains composed during the attack, but Dolin criticizes her for endangering her attendants and an innocent bystander through inadequate protection. 18
Afterward, Ariel summons Dolin and presses him to resume his duties. Despite their hostile early interactions, she persists in her intention to claim the throne, declaring that the deaths of her companions will not make her retreat. Dolin subsequently trains her guards, mages, and attendants in swordsmanship, magic, healing, and detoxification for over a year. 19
Ariel enters a political partnership with Dolin after his return from his adventuring journey. He offers strategy, protection, and support for her bid for the throne, while Ariel seeks to understand his wider objectives. 28
Following the Teleportation Incident, Ariel survives when a Demonic Beast falls into the royal palace grounds. Her guardian mage Derrick Redbat and other guards are killed, while the amnesiac Sylphie saves Ariel by defeating the beast. 29
Ariel takes responsibility for the Fittoa Territory Children’s Refugee Camp, established from Dolin’s exhibition venue and supplies. The effort strengthens her public reputation among the people of Ars. 30
She later relocates to Ranoa University of Magic in Sharia, where she becomes Student Council President with the support of her guards. Her political objective becomes securing the backing of Armored Dragon King Perugius, whose prestige could make her claim to the throne viable. 34 35
When Ariel finally visits Perugius aboard Chaos Breaker, he challenges her to identify the most important quality of a king. Though initially unable to answer, she reflects on the expectations and sacrifices of her companions. Perugius ultimately agrees to support her return to Asura and her claim to the throne. 69 89 90
Luke’s jealousy of Dolin escalates into betrayal after he attempts to harm Dolin’s allies and takes Elmoia and Clini hostage. Ariel initially struggles to believe that her longtime Guardian Knight would turn against her, but Luke is killed after Dolin defeats him and his accomplices. 81 82
With Perugius’s backing and no safe alternative to remaining abroad, Ariel returns to Ars to openly contend with First Prince Gravel for succession. She is welcomed by civilians, reunites with her ailing father King Leonard, and vows to protect the Asura Kingdom and its people. 97 102 103
Ariel conducts an intensive campaign among the nobility while enduring repeated assassination attempts. After using Perugius’s appearance at a grand assembly to challenge Gravel’s faction, she consolidates control over the kingdom’s military and political institutions. She is formally crowned Queen of Asura, with Dolin publicly named Prince Dolin and Asura’s First Knight. 104 105 108 122
As queen, Ariel delegates most routine administration to her ministers while retaining control over major policy and political direction. She later maintains her position in Asura while also being recognized as Empress Ariel alongside Sunless Emperor Dolin. 120 238

Personality
Ariel is ambitious, politically perceptive, and socially adept. She understands the importance of public goodwill, noble alliances, and influential external supporters in a struggle for the throne. 17 29 35
She is resolute despite danger and personal loss. After the assassination attempt, she insists that she will not abandon her goal of becoming ruler simply because the path is dangerous. 19
Ariel can quickly assess political realities. She rejects the idea of gaining the throne solely through Dolin’s magical coercion, recognizing that a ruler without noble legitimacy would face disobedience and further assassination attempts. 35
In private, she becomes increasingly open and teasing with Dolin, while retaining a composed exterior even when he provokes her. 35 42 45
Ariel possesses considerable personal charisma despite lacking notable magical or swordsmanship ability. She treats followers warmly, makes outsiders feel included, and inspires fierce loyalty from guards and attendants who are willing to risk their lives for her. 103
Although she is capable of decisive political action, Ariel can be anxious about her suitability for kingship and later regrets being unable to share in the founding of Dolin’s new nation. Her vulnerability is most apparent in private conversations with Dolin, where she admits that becoming queen has left her feeling constrained by the path she chose. 67 69 140
Political Activities
Public Support
Ariel cultivates influence among commoners and the military through charitable visits, ceremonies, speeches, and honors for returning knights. Her attendants also work through their family connections to build support for her claim. 17 50
Upon returning to Ars, Ariel’s crest is greeted by cheering civilians. She subsequently expands her campaign through balls, private noble gatherings, and alliances secured by the formidable guard force around her. 102 104
Refugee Relief
After the Teleportation Incident, Ariel assumes public responsibility for the Fittoa Territory Children’s Refugee Camp. The camp shelters displaced children using a former exhibition site and pre-positioned supplies. 30
The former camp later develops into a large school for displaced children, funded through the period of Ariel’s political struggle. Its curriculum includes basic literacy as well as magic and swordsmanship instruction. 104 113
Ranoa University of Magic
At Ranoa University, Ariel becomes Student Council President and uses the school as a base for building connections. She seeks local noble investment, recruits useful talent, and is advised to prioritize magic-tool craftsmen and magic-education specialists for her future government. 34 42
Her university faction also defeats the Beast-kin students who had been terrorizing other students, establishing the Student Council’s authority within the academy. 34
Perugius’s Support
Ariel considers Perugius’s support essential because her domestic noble backing alone is insufficient to overcome her brothers’ factions. Perugius tests her understanding of kingship rather than immediately granting his endorsement, forcing her to confront the purpose behind her ambition. 29 69
After Ariel resolves to honor the hopes of the companions who supported and died for her cause, Perugius agrees to aid her return to Ars. His public appearance at her grand assembly becomes a decisive political demonstration against Gravel’s supporters. 89 90 105
Claim to the Throne
Ariel’s position in Ars was initially weak compared with her elder brothers because noble support was limited. Her planned path to power relied on gaining Perugius’s support while maintaining the surviving members of her retinue. 29 35
After returning to Asura, Ariel organizes her supporters, withstands numerous assassination attempts, and works to dismantle the influence of the Prodia, Notos, and Boreas houses aligned with Gravel. 104 108
Reign as Queen
Ariel is crowned after Gravel’s faction is defeated and the opposition’s criminal evidence falls into her hands. She receives the Asuran crown and scepter, takes the royal oath, and is recognized by the royal-bloodline ceremonial platform. 122
As queen, Ariel generally delegates routine ministerial reports and administrative work while personally directing matters of major national importance. She also grants Dolin the title of Prince Dolin and the authority of Asura’s First Knight. 120 122
